§ 7B-904 — Authority over parents of juvenile adjudicated as abused, neglected, or dependent

North Carolina·Ch. 7B Juvenile Code·Art. 9 Dispositions·Subch. I ABUSE, NEGLECT, DEPENDENCY
(a)If the court orders medical, surgical, psychiatric, psychological, or other treatment pursuant to G.S. 7B-903, the court may order the parent or other responsible parties to pay the cost of the treatment or care ordered.
(b)At the dispositional hearing or a subsequent hearing if the court finds that it is in the best interests of the juvenile for the parent, guardian, custodian, stepparent, adult member of the juvenile's household, or adult entrusted with the juvenile's care to be directly involved in the juvenile's treatment, the court may order the parent, guardian, custodian, stepparent, adult member of the juvenile's household, or adult entrusted with the juvenile's care to participate in medical, psychiatric, psychological, or other treatment of the juvenile.
